That …A line producer is a professional in the film or television industry who manages the financial and logistical aspects of a production. They report to the producer and supervise heads of departments. Their financial responsibilities include making sure spending levels remain within the budget. A producer works throughout the whole filmmaking process. They are often the first person on a project and the last to leave. Here is a breakdown of a producer’s main responsibilities. Pre-production. Sourcing of the screenplay. Finds funding for the film. Hires cast and crew. Helps create a production schedule. The most realistic way for many is a chain of command through the production office. Apply and throw your name out there for Office PA work, work your way up through the Secretary position and into the Production Coordinators circle. Get unionized, settle your life after hustling for a few years to get to that spot.
